Output 81bf02cb8d897eada2836c0c57356455a06c62d31cd245423cfd6bc320dfb637:0

value
1195430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4c047718bca6336d0ac281f617d68eae10cf47 OP_EQUAL
address
3JmMMCapuWkyfY6EJtnj7CAkRSMnVYaTqY
transaction
81bf02cb8d897eada2836c0c57356455a06c62d31cd245423cfd6bc320dfb637
confirmations
326123
spent
true